4***@qq.com
4***@qq.com
  • 发布:2024-12-12 18:08
  • 更新:2024-12-12 18:17
  • 阅读:116

【报Bug】ios微信小程序多个输入框切换,输入框焦点概率获取失败问题

分类:uni-app

产品分类: uniapp/小程序/微信

PC开发环境操作系统: Windows

PC开发环境操作系统版本号: Windows 10 专业版

HBuilderX类型: 正式

HBuilderX版本号: 4.41

第三方开发者工具版本号: 1.06.2312061

基础库版本号: 3.3.3

项目创建方式: HBuilderX

操作步骤:

官方的示例 dome,input演示就能复现。https://github.com/dcloudio/hello-uniapp
见附件视频

预期结果:

ios手机,从一个输入框,点击切换到另一个输入框时,另一个输入框应该能直接获取焦点,而不是需要再去点第二次(如微信小程序自己的官方示例)

实际结果:

概率能切换,大概率失败。

bug描述:

微信小程序同一个页面有多个输入框,在点击切换时,ios手机大概率无法获取焦点,需要二次进行点击输入框获取焦点。很影响交互体验。

2024-12-12 18:08 负责人:无 分享
已邀请:
4***@qq.com

4***@qq.com (作者)

复现视频附件

4***@qq.com

4***@qq.com (作者)

期间尝试使用input的always-embed属性解决此问题,加了的确有缓解,但是增加always-embed属性后,输入框的光标位置在ios微信小程序中,每次获取焦点都在内容的开始位置,而不是末尾,更加影响使用,所有放弃了。

要回复问题请先登录注册